Legal proceedings against Kerala MLA Mani C. Kappan

Overview

Mani C. Kappan, a Member of the Legislative Assembly (MLA) from Kerala’s Pala constituency, was sentenced by a Mumbai court to one year of simple imprisonment in a cheque-bounce case involving a dispute over shares in Kannur International Airport. The court ordered Kappan to pay ₹1.20 crore in compensation to businessman Dinesh Menon, plus 9% simple interest.

Following the conviction, a petition was filed in the Kerala High Court seeking Kappan’s disqualification from his legislative office. The petition notes that the total sentence across four cheque dishonor cases amounts to three and a half years of imprisonment. Citing the Representation of the People Act, 1951, and legal precedents, the petitioner argues that the conviction necessitates immediate disqualification and requests that the Speaker of the Kerala Assembly declare the Pala seat vacant to allow for a bye-election.
